At SiGMA Africa, Oluwafisayo Oke, CEO of Gamble Alert, explores the realities of Nigeria’s fragmented gaming regulation and the shift towards a more unified framework. He discusses the role of the Federation of State Gaming Regulators of Nigeria in streamlining licensing and advancing player protection policies across states. The conversation highlights the rollout of the Safe Play Initiative, a unified self-exclusion system, alongside key challenges such as funding gaps and operator readiness.
